Piccolo Morini marks the newest opening from Altamarea Group — the acclaimed hospitality company behind Marea, Ai Fiori, and 53 — debuting in SoHo with a vibrant, pasta-driven menu rooted in the traditions of Northern Italy. A natural evolution of the beloved Osteria Morini, Piccolo Morini brings a renewed sense of energy to the neighborhood through handcrafted pastas, Italian small plates, and a lively, convivial dining experience. At its core, Piccolo Morini reflects everything guests have come to love about the Morini legacy: soulful cooking, genuine hospitality, and a warm, unpretentious atmosphere. Job Responsibility:
Support the Executive Chef in all aspects of kitchen operations
Lead and manage kitchen team members, ensuring consistency, quality, and efficiency
Execute and oversee all menu items with precision and adherence to Altamarea Group standards
Train, mentor, and develop BOH staff, fostering a culture of accountability and growth
Manage daily prep, service, and station organization
Maintain and enforce all food safety, sanitation, and DOH regulations
Assist in inventory management, ordering, and cost control (food cost, waste, etc.)
Ensure proper staffing levels and support scheduling need
Maintain a strong presence during service, leading by example on the line
Collaborate with FOH leadership to ensure seamless service and guest satisfaction
Uphold cleanliness, organization, and kitchen maintenance standards
